¿Cuál es tu excusa para no tener tests?

11
¿Cuál es tu excusa para no tener tests? #BTOS2012

description

Presentación de la Barcelona Testing Open Space 2012 #BTOS2012

Transcript of ¿Cuál es tu excusa para no tener tests?

Page 1: ¿Cuál es tu excusa para no tener tests?

¿Cuál es tu excusa para no tener

tests?

#BTOS2012

Page 2: ¿Cuál es tu excusa para no tener tests?

Pablo Bouzada@pbousan

www.programandonet.com

[T]echdencias

Page 3: ¿Cuál es tu excusa para no tener tests?

¿Cómo le justifico al cliente que hay que hacer pruebas de todo? ¿Es que no sabes programar?

Inicio del proyecto

¿Por qué no hacemos TDD? Si además de picar

tengo que hacer tests, no acabaré nunca. Ya vendrá alguien de QA para eso.

#BTOS2012

Page 4: ¿Cuál es tu excusa para no tener tests?

Ya haremos tests más adelante, que ahora no hay nada que probar.

Inicio del proyecto

¿Por qué no hacemos TDD?

El mejor test es que la aplicación funcione

#BTOS2012

Page 5: ¿Cuál es tu excusa para no tener tests?

¿Tests de regresión? Pero si esto se prueba entero en media hora.

El proyecto avanza

¿Y unos tests de carga? ¿o de regresión? Algo, por favor.

Tenemos mucho que hacer, no me hagas perder el tiempo con eso.

#BTOS2012

Page 6: ¿Cuál es tu excusa para no tener tests?

El proyecto avanza

¿Y unos tests de carga? ¿o de regresión? Algo, por favor.

Tenemos mucho que hacer, no me hagas perder el tiempo con eso.

¿Tests de carga? Ya lo probaremos antes de subir a producción.

#BTOS2012

Page 7: ¿Cuál es tu excusa para no tener tests?

No sé para qué hacemos tests unitarios, si total con C&P del anterior.

El proyecto avanza

¿Y unos tests de carga? ¿o de regresión? Algo, por favor.

#BTOS2012

Page 8: ¿Cuál es tu excusa para no tener tests?

El cliente dice que el tiempo de carga es inaceptable. Hazme unos tests de carga y si no salen, te los inventas.

Fase final

Aparecen bugs, nada funciona. Esto es un desastre…

Cómo que no pasa los tests de carga, si en mi máquina va de p..ta madre.

#BTOS2012

Page 9: ¿Cuál es tu excusa para no tener tests?

Que tests ni que tests, ya sabía yo que no sabéis hacer nada bien…

Este bug no sé cómo salió. Pero lo arreglo en 10 minutos, que sé dónde hay que tocar.

Fase final

Aparecen bugs, nada funciona. Esto es un desastre…

#BTOS2012

Page 10: ¿Cuál es tu excusa para no tener tests?

Que se oiga tu opinión…

Page 11: ¿Cuál es tu excusa para no tener tests?

MUCHAS GRACIAS!!Pablo Bouzada

@pbousan

www.programandonet.com

[T]echdencias